Uova Con Salsa Di Pomodoro - Eggs with Tomato Sauce

Eggs aren't just for Easter baskets anymore! This recipe is one tasty breakfast idea.

Ingredients:

  • 6 eggs
  • 4 tbs. olive oileggs
  • 1 clove garlic, chopped
  • 1 canned tomatoes
  • 1 tbs. chopped parsley
  • Pinch of crushed red pepper seeds
  • 1 small onion, sliced
  • Salt to taste

Heat olive oil in large shallow saucepan. Cook onion and garlic about 2 minutes or until soft. Add tomatoes, parsley, crushed pepper seeds, and salt to taste. Simmer over low flame about 25 minutes. Drop eggs in sauce one at a time, without breaking yolks. Cook slowly for 3 minutes or until egg whites are firm. Serve hot.  Serves 6.pdf

Tomato and Cucumber Salad

Adjust the amount of chilly to your taste. Wear plastic or rubber gloves while handling the chilies to protect skin from the oil in them. Avoid direct contact with eyes, and wash hands thoroughly after handling.

  • 2 tomatoes, dicedtoamtoe
  • 1 medium cucumber, peeled, seeded, and diced
  • 3 scallions, chopped
  • 1 fresh jalapeno chile, cored, seeded, and diced
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
  • 2 teaspoons sugar
  • Cilantro leaves, chopped
  • Salt
  1. In a medium bowl, combined all the ingredients, adding the cilantro leaves and salt to taste. Keep refrigerated until ready to serve.pdf

Potato-Carrot Charloote

  • carrots1 cup grated carrots
  • 3/4 cup water
  • 3 cups grated, drained potatoes
  • 3 egg yolks, beaten
  • 4 tablespoons cracker meal
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ons salt
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on ginger
  • 4 tablespoons melted butter or fat
  • 3 stiffly beaten egg whites

Cook the carrots in the water for 15 minutes. Let cool in the water.pdfMix the potatoes, egg yolks, cracker meal, salt, sugar, ginger, butter or fat and the undrained carrots. Fold in the egg whites. Turn into a greased 2 quart baking dish. Bake in a 350 degree oven for 1 hour. Serve hot. Serves 6 to 8.

Onion Charloote

Ingredients:

  • 4 cups diced onions
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• ½ cup milkonion
  • 3 egg yolks
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/8 teaspoon pepper
  • 1 cup light cream
  • 1/3 cup bread crumbs

pdfCook the onions, butter and milk over low heat for 10 minutes. Drain and turn into a buttered 9 inch pie plate. Beat the egg yolks, salt, pepper and cream together. Pour over the onions and sprinkle with the bread crumbs. Bake in a 350 degree oven for 35 minutes or until set. Serve hot. Serves 6.

Noodles and Cabbage

Ingredients:

  • 1 tablespoon saltnoodle2
  • 4 cups finely shredded cabbage
  • ½ cup butter or fat
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• ¼ teaspoon pepper
  • 3 cups cooked broad noodles, drained

Mix the salt and cabbage together and let stand 30 minutes. Squeeze out all the liquid. Heat the butter or fat in a deep skillet. Cook over low heat for 45 minutes or until cabbage is brown. Stir very frequently. Add to the noodles and toss to blend. Serves 6 to 8.pdf
